Vulnerability from github – Published: 2026-07-25 12:31 – Updated: 2026-07-25 12:31In the Linux kernel, the following vulnerability has been resolved:
Bluetooth: btmtksdio: fix infinite loop in btmtksdio_txrx_work()
Every once in a while we see a hung btmtksdio_flush() task:
INFO: task kworker/u17:0:189 blocked for more than 122 seconds. __cancel_work_timer+0x3f4/0x460 cancel_work_sync+0x1c/0x2c btmtksdio_flush+0x2c/0x40 hci_dev_open_sync+0x10c4/0x2190 [..]
It all boils down to incorrect time_is_before_jiffies() usage in
btmtksdio_txrx_work(). The btmtksdio_txrx_work() loop is expected
to be terminated if running for longer than 5HZ. However the
timeout check is twisted: time_is_before_jiffies(old_jiffies + 5HZ)
evaluates to true when old_jiffies + 5*HZ is in the past i.e. when a
timeout has occurred. Using OR with time_is_before_jiffies(txrx_timeout)
means that:
- before the 5-second timeout: the condition is int_status || false,
so it loops as long as there are pending interrupts.
- after the 5-second timeout: the condition becomes int_status || true,
which is always true.
When the loop becomes infinite btmtksdio_txrx_work() loop never terminates and never releases the SDIO host.
Fix loop termination condition to actually enforce a 5*HZ timeout.
